How many two digit numbers divisible by neither 3 nor 5?

48.The first two digit number is 10, the last two digit number is 99, so there are 99 - 10 + 1 = 90 two digit numbers→ 10 ÷ 3 = 31/3 → first two digit number divisible by 3 is 4 x 3 = 12→ 99 ÷ 3 = 33 → last two digit number divisible by 3 is 33 x 3 = 99→ 33 - 4 + 1 = 30 two digit numbers divisible by 3→ 10 ÷ 5 = 2 → first two digit number divisible by 5 is 2 x 5 = 10→ 99 ÷ 5 = 194/5 → last two digit number divisible by 5 is 19 x 5 = 95→ 19 - 2 + 1 = 18 two digit numbers divisible by 5→ 30 + 18 = 48 two digit numbers divisible by 3 or 5 OR BOTH.The numbers divisible by both are multiples of their lowest common multiple: lcm(3, 5) = 15, and have been counted twice, so need to be subtracted from the total→ 10 ÷ 15 = 010/15 → first two digit number divisible by 15 is 1 x 15 = 15→ 99 ÷ 15 = 69/15 → last two digit number divisible by 15 is 6 x 15 = 90→ 6 - 1 + 1 = 6 two digit numbers divisible by 15 (the lcm of 3 and 5)→ 48 - 6 = 42 two digit numbers divisible by 3 or 5.→ 90 - 42 = 48 two digit numbers divisible by neither 3 nor 5.


What are the divisibility rules for 1 2 3 4 5 6 9 and 10?

All whole numbers are divisible by 1. Numbers are divisible by 2 if they end in 2, 4, 6, 8 or 0. Numbers are divisible by 3 if the sum of their digits is divisible by 3. Numbers are divisible by 4 if the last two digits of the number are divisible by 4. Numbers are divisible by 5 if the last digit of the number is either 5 or 0. Numbers are divisible by 6 if they are divisible by 2 and 3. Numbers are divisible by 9 if the sum of their digits is equal to 9 or a multiple of 9. Numbers are divisible by 10 if the last digit of the number is 0.
